4 Key Innovations Driving Market Adoption
1. Dynamic Voltage Regulation
Erda's proprietary technology maintains stable output even during 30% voltage fluctuations - crucial for regions with unstable grids.
2. Modular Scalability
- Expand capacity without system shutdowns
- 5-minute hot-swap functionality
- 25% lower installation costs vs conventional models
3. Smart Thermal Management
Patented cooling system enables continuous operation at 55°C ambient temperature - perfect for desert solar projects.

FAQ: Inverter Selection Guide
Q: How often should inverters be maintained? A: Annual professional inspections with monthly remote diagnostics.
Q: What's the typical payback period? A: 4-7 years depending on energy prices and utilization rates.
